数控机床铣凹槽怎么编程

时间:2025-01-27 05:59:22 网络游戏

数控机床铣凹槽编程步骤

1. 确定凹槽形状和尺寸

根据工件图纸要求,明确凹槽的 形状(如直线、圆弧等)和 尺寸(如宽度、深度、长度等)。

2. 装夹工件

将工件正确装夹在数控铣床上,确保其稳定且便于加工。

3. 编程与模拟

选择编程语言:常用的数控编程语言有G代码和M代码。G代码用于描述机床的运动轨迹,M代码用于控制机床的辅助功能。

编写加工程序

初始设定:包括快速定位(G00)、主轴启动(M03)等。

刀具路径规划:根据凹槽形状和尺寸,规划合理的刀具路径,使用直线插补(G01)、圆弧插补(G02/G03)等指令。

切削参数设置:根据材料硬度和铣削方式,设置切削速度、进给速度和切削深度等。

刀具半径补偿:根据刀具半径大小,使用G41/G42指令进行补偿,确保加工尺寸准确。

程序校验与修改:在模拟环境中校验程序,发现问题及时修改。

4. 程序执行

将编写好的数控程序加载到数控机床上,进行模拟运行和调试。

调试完成后,将工件固定在数控机床上,启动加工程序进行加工操作。

5. 加工过程中的注意事项

注意刀具与工件的位置、角度、切削力等,保证加工精度和质量。

加工过程中及时检查加工质量,确保符合要求。

示例代码

```plaintext

N10: 程序起始标号

G90: 绝对坐标模式

G40: 刀具半径补偿取消

G54: 工件坐标系选择

N20: 选择刀具和刀具切换(T1 M06)

N30: 切削进给率补偿选择(G43 H01 Z1.)

N40: 主轴转速和主轴方向选择(S1000 M03)

N50: 快速定位(G00 X10. Y10.)

N60: 线性插补(G01 Z-5. F200.)

N70-N100: 进行凹槽的切削加工

N110: 快速撤退(G00 Z10.)

N120: 程序结束(M30)

```

结论

数控机床铣凹槽的编程步骤包括确定凹槽形状和尺寸、装夹工件、编程与模拟、程序执行以及加工过程中的注意事项。通过合理选择编程语言和指令,可以确保凹槽加工的精度和效率。在实际编程过程中,还需要根据具体的加工要求和机床特性进行调整和优化。